What Is an Immigration Bond
An immigration bond is a monetary guarantee that allows a held immigrant to be let out from ICE custody while their immigration case advances through the court system. Comparable to a bail bond in the criminal justice framework, an immigration bond ensures that the individual will appear at all planned immigration proceedings. There are two key kinds of immigration bonds: delivery bonds and voluntary departure bonds. A delivery bond enables the detained individual to be freed so they can spend time with loved ones and meet with their legal representative while awaiting their hearing. A voluntary departure bond allows the person to exit the nation voluntarily by a specified date, with the bond sum returned upon departure.
The sum of an immigration bond may differ greatly, often ranging from $1,500 to $25,000 or more, according to the details of the case. Factors like the individual’s criminal record, flight risk, connections to the community, and immigration status all shape the bond figure decided by an immigration court judge. An immigration attorney has the ability to additionally identify upfront whether a detained individual is even qualified for bond — a critical first step that families commonly overlook. Specific immigration infractions immediately bar someone from bond eligibility, including aggravated felony convictions and terrorism-related accusations. Without this information, families may spend precious time and resources chasing a bond hearing that was never a realistic option. How an Attorney Can Reduce Bond Amounts
In many cases, the first bond figure set by ICE is unjustifiably high, putting an tremendous financial burden on households who are currently facing hardships. An immigration bond lawyer can petition for a bond redetermination hearing in front of an immigration court judge to argue for a more reasonable bond amount. During this hearing, the attorney puts forward proof and legal reasoning to show that a lower bond is appropriate given the individual’s circumstances.
The process requires strategic planning and a profound grasp of what immigration judges evaluate when determining bond figures. Attorneys understand how to structure cases persuasively, underscore positive elements, and challenge any claims made by the government about risk of flight or threat to the public. Who is eligible to receive an immigration bond in Irvington, NY?
Not all detained individuals are eligible for an immigration bond. Eligibility hinges on multiple factors, including the nature of the immigration accusations, criminal history, and whether the detainee represents a risk to the community or a flight risk. Individuals subject to mandatory detention on account of certain criminal convictions or security concerns may not be eligible for a bond. What happens if the immigration bond conditions are not met in Irvington, NY?
If the individual freed on an immigration bond neglects to appear at their designated immigration court appointments or breaks the conditions of their freedom, the bond will be surrendered, indicating the entire bond sum will not be refunded to the person who posted it. Additionally, the held person could be liable for re-arrest, and their refusal to comply can adversely affect the result of their immigration case.
